POSITION DESCRIPTION:

The Actualization Analyst is responsible for managing all product movements in ETRM system [i.e. RightAngle] for Guttman Energys East Coast division, located in Bel Air, MD. This involves ensuring that all customer movements are analyzed and actualized to the correct deal in ETRM system in a timely manner. Additionally, the Actualization Analyst will create and maintain automatcher rules. This position is an exempt position and reports to the Manager of Operational Accounting. The Actualization Analyst position is located in Bel Air, MD.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Manage all rack and bulk movements:
    • Match movements to sale/purchase/inventory deals.
    • Analyze and correct any movements that do not match.
    • Ensure matching is consistent with customer lifting logs.
    • Create manual movements for transfers.
    • Validate that all movements are processed.
    • Ensure all daily movements are received from third party sources.
  • Create ethanol and bio-diesel movements into inventory for loads purchased.
  • Analyze daily accounting transactions for the East Coast division.
  • Collaborate with the Sales, Supply, and Inventory teams to analyze the divisions daily inventory position.
  • Create and maintain ETRM system automatcher rules.
  • Work closely with the Master Data Team on all new customer and supplier set up.
  • Perform month-end processing tasks.
  • Collaborate with the Sales team and directly with customers to resolve unmatched or incorrectly matched movements.
  • Perform other duties and ad hoc analysis as assigned.
